  Mean Streets (1973)

A young hood in New York's Little Italy contends with saving the neck of his hotheaded best friend from the local loan shark and struggles with the religious guilt prompted by his lifestyle. (read more)

Starring: Robert De Niro
Harvey Keitel
David Proval
Richard Romanus
Directed By: Martin Scorsese
